Mar. 4, 2010

KUALA LUMPUR, Malaysia (AP) -- Rhys Davies and Ignacio Garrido have shot 7-under 65s to lead the Malaysian Open by one stroke after the first round on Thursday.

Thongchai Jaidee and Kim Dae-hyun shot 66s, and seven-time PGA TOUR winner K.J. Choi had a 67 to tie for fifth alongside Mark Foster, Alejandro Canizares and Mark Haastrup at the Kuala Lumpur Golf and Country Club.

Davies, who has played on the Asian Tour for the last two years, made seven birdies.
